Mattie Tanis was born in Paterson New Jersey. Throughout her childhood, she lived with her large family on Bergen Street. Although the 1910 census demonstrates that the entire Tanis family was able to speak English, the 1920 census listed Dutch as the mother tongue of even the New Jersey born children.
Starting in her mid-teens, Mattie worked as a winder and silk warper in the Paterson silk mills [1]. After her marriage, she was a housewife.
Her father belonged to the Ebenezer Netherland Reformed Church on lower Haledon Avenue in Paterson. She and her sisters felt that this church was far too strict for their tastes. So, when they married, they did so in other churches. [2]
Following the death of her husband, she lived with her son in Butler, NJ.
